以前からこちらのブログのreCAPTCHAが遅いと感じていた。GIGAZINの記事でhCaptchaのことを知った。速度に関しては記載がなかったが、試してみようと思い移行しました。
目次
結果
Page Speed Insights スコアが70点台から90点台へ変わりました。
何をしたのか
reCAPTCHAからhCaptchaへ切り替え
具体的なやり方
STEP
メール認証
メールアドレス 国籍を入力して サインアップします。 そのうち「メールアドレスを確認してください」というメールが届くので「メールアドレスの確認」ボタンを押します。
STEP
サイトキーと秘密鍵を取得
サイトキーと秘密鍵(シークレットキー)が表示されます。 この状態で新しいタブを開きワードプレスにログインします。
STEP
プラグインを入れる
プラグイン→新規追加→hCaptchaと検索→hCaptcha for WordPressをインストール
STEP
設定
hCaptcha Site Key にSTEP3で入手したサイトキー hCaptcha Secret Key に秘密鍵(シークレットキー)を入れる。
Enable/Disable Features にてスパムを防ぎたいものに関してチェックを入れる。
機能一覧 | Google翻訳 |
---|---|
Turn off when logged in | ログイン時にオフにする |
Disable reCAPTCHA Compatibility (use if including both hCaptcha and reCAPTCHA on the same page) | reCAPTCHA互換性を無効にします(同じページにhCaptchaとreCAPTCHAの両方を含める場合に使用します) |
Enable hCaptcha on Login Form | ログインフォームでhCaptchaを有効にする |
Enable hCaptcha on Register Form | 登録フォームでhCaptchaを有効にする |
Enable hCaptcha on Lost Password Form | 紛失したパスワードフォームでhCaptchaを有効にする |
Enable hCaptcha on Comment Form | コメントフォームでhCaptchaを有効にする |
Enable hCaptcha on bbPress New Topic Form | bbPressの新しいトピックフォームでhCaptchaを有効にする |
Enable hCaptcha on bbPress Reply Form | bbPress返信フォームでhCaptchaを有効にする |
Enable hCaptcha on BuddyPress Create Group Form | BuddyPress CreateGroupFormでhCaptchaを有効にする |
Enable hCaptcha on BuddyPress Registration Form | BuddyPress登録フォームでhCaptchaを有効にする |
Enable hCaptcha on Contact Form 7 | Contact Form 7でhCaptchaを有効にする |
Enable hCaptcha on Divi Contact Form | Diviお問い合わせフォームでhCaptchaを有効にする |
Enable hCaptcha on Divi Login Form | DiviログインフォームでhCaptchaを有効にする |
Enable hCaptcha on Elementor Pro Form | ElementorProフォームでhCaptchaを有効にする |
Enable hCaptcha on Fluent Form | FluentFormでhCaptchaを有効にする |
Enable hCaptcha on Gravity Form | GravityFormでhCaptchaを有効にする |
Enable hCaptcha on Jetpack Contact Form | Jetpackお問い合わせフォームでhCaptchaを有効にする |
Enable hCaptcha on Mailchimp for WP Form | MailchimpforWPフォームでhCaptchaを有効にする |
Enable hCaptcha on MemberPress Registration Form | MemberPress登録フォームでhCaptchaを有効にする |
Enable hCaptcha on Ninja Forms | 忍者フォームでhCaptchaを有効にする |
Enable hCaptcha on Subscribers Form | サブスクライバーフォームでhCaptchaを有効にする |
Enable hCaptcha on WooCommerce Login Form | WooCommerceログインフォームでhCaptchaを有効にする |
Enable hCaptcha on WooCommerce Registration Form | WooCommerce登録フォームでhCaptchaを有効にする |
Enable hCaptcha on WooCommerce Lost Password Form | WooCommerceのパスワード紛失フォームでhCaptchaを有効にする |
Enable hCaptcha on WooCommerce Checkout Form | WooCommerceチェックアウトフォームでhCaptchaを有効にする |
Enable hCaptcha on WooCommerce Order Tracking Form | WooCommerce注文追跡フォームでhCaptchaを有効にする |
Enable hCaptcha on WooCommerce Wishlists Create List Form | WooCommerceウィッシュリストでhCaptchaを有効にするリストフォームを作成する |
Enable hCaptcha on WPForms Lite Enable hCaptcha on WPForms Pro | WPFormsLiteでhCaptchaを有効にするWPFormsProでhCaptchaを有効にする |
Enable hCaptcha on WPForo New Topic Form | WPForoの新しいトピックフォームでhCaptchaを有効にする |
Save hCaptcha Settings
以上
PageSpeed Insights
効果が大きかった。
感想
思いのほか改善されたので驚いた。 あとはどのくらいスパムが防げるかがわかりません。2023/3/28時点ではスパムなし。
追記
タイトルを変更しました2023/3/28
コメント